tl https support

Norbert Preining norbert at
Wed Apr 15 03:11:56 CEST 2020

Hi Philip,

with today's tlcritical we are shipping a curl with ssl support for
Windows, as well as a set of certificates.

On Windows10 which already ships a working curl I tested it with
TEXLIVE_PREFER_OWN=1 env variable, but I would like to see whether it
works on Windows 7, too.

Could you please:
- update texlive.infra from tlcritical
- get your wget out of the way, so that only system provided stuff
  is available
- after that run the following
	tlmgr --repository -v -v shell

  Then, at the tlmgr> prompt please type
	load local
  and send me the output, please.

Here is a session running the same on my linux computer:

$ tlmgr --repository -v -v shell
D:action = shell
DD:location =>
D:appending to package log file: /home/norbert/tl/2020/texmf-var/web2c/tlmgr.log
DD:tlmgr:main: do persistent downloads = 1
DD:setup_persistent_downloads has net_lib_avail set
DD:TLUtils:setup_persistent_downloads: got ::tldownload_server
D:tlmgr:main: ::tldownload_server hash:: {enabled:1,errorcount:0,initcount:0,initcout:1,ua:LWP::UserAgent=HASH(0x560e5b111e10)}
protocol 1
tlmgr> load local
DD:TLPDB new: verify=0
D:setup_programs: preferring system versions
DD:trying to set up system curl, arg --version
D:program curl found in path
DD:trying to set up system wget, arg --version
D:program wget found in path
DD:trying to set up system lz4, arg --version
D:program lz4 found in path
DD:trying to set up system gzip, arg --version
D:program gzip found in path
DD:trying to set up system xz, arg --version
D:program xz found in path
DD:dumping $::progs = {
  'compressor' => 'lz4',
  'curl' => 'curl',
  'gzip' => 'gzip',
  'lz4' => 'lz4',
  'tar' => 'tar',
  'wget' => 'wget',
  'working_compressors' => [
  'working_downloaders' => [
  'xz' => 'xz'
tlmgr> quit



